Summary of the comparison

St Mary and St Benedict Catholic Primary School and Sidney Stringer Primary Academy are primary schools in Coventry.

  • St Mary and St Benedict Catholic Primary School scores 52 out of 100 (grade D, below average) and Sidney Stringer Primary Academy scores 62 out of 100 (grade C, average). Sidney Stringer Primary Academy is ahead on our composite score.

  • St Mary and St Benedict Catholic Primary School was judged Good and Sidney Stringer Primary Academy was judged strong.

  • On the share of pupils meeting the expected standard in reading, writing and maths at Key Stage 2, the latest published figures are 63.0% for St Mary and St Benedict Catholic Primary School and 69.0% for Sidney Stringer Primary Academy.

  • The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has risen at St Mary and St Benedict Catholic Primary School (47.0% in 2022-23, 63.0% in 2024-25) and has fallen at Sidney Stringer Primary Academy (74.0% in 2022-23, 69.0% in 2024-25).
